The next Formula 1 race of the season will be the Dutch Grand Prix at Zandvoort Circuit outside of Amsterdam this Sunday. While the race is notable for its coastal track set amid the sand dunes by the North Sea, it's also earned a reputation for having some of the most energetic fans around; most will be dressed in orange come race time. Formula 1 Practices and qualifying races will take place on Friday and Saturday, and the Grand Prix is scheduled for Sunday at 9 a.m. ET.

If you're tuning in from home, you should know that this year, F1 has moved to streaming exclusively on Apple TV in the U.S. So if you want to catch this weekend's race in Zandvoort live, you'll need access to Apple TV (or F1 TV Premium, now free with an Apple TV subscription). F1 races used to air on ESPN and ESPN2 in the U.S., but Apple TV has signed an exclusive five-year deal to be the U.S. broadcaster of Formula 1 starting this season. That means the Dutch Grand Prix and every other race of the 2026 F1 season will stream live on Apple TV.

Dutch Grand Prix schedule 

All times Eastern

Friday, August 21

  • Practice 1: 6:30 a.m.

  • Sprint Qualifying: 10:30 a.m.

Saturday, August 22

  • Sprint: 6 a.m.

  • Qualifying: 10:00 a.m.

Sunday, August 23

  • Formula 1 Dutch Grand Prix: 9:00 a.m.
